Gameplay is choppy because there are times when you are taking fire and cannot move or are stuck. The basic premise in firefights is to take cover. So you press your button and the game makes you take cover when you really wanted to run. You also can be pressing your button and it will not take cover and you will get hit. Nothing worse then being in a firefight and pressing buttons and you are covering and not firing or its not taking cover. They should have taken care of that but seeing as how this is the last one no need to.
In games like this I have found it suffers from what most games like this do. Its very easy at parts and then it gets way too hard. It uses the simple technique of overloading you with too many enemies. After awhile it becomes boring because again not much difference in the missions. It basically becomes a button masher except mashing the buttons sometimes hurts you and not helps. Now a lot has been talked about the ending or to me lack thereof. There is not end boss nothing spectacualr about the ending of this game. You are in a mission do some things and its over. No excitement nothing. Its a very poor ending to a trilogy.
